21xrx.com
2024-11-22 12:38:19 Friday
登录
文章检索 我的文章 写文章
Java中的对象初识:初始化
2023-06-14 21:34:02 深夜i     --     --
Java 对象初始化 构造器 对象初始化块

在Java编程中,初始化是非常重要的一个步骤。它为对象赋初值,设置它的状态,为后续操作提供基础。但是,Java中到底用什么方法对对象进行初始化呢?

首先,我们需要知道对象的创建方式。在Java中,对象的创建是通过使用new运算符来实现的。一般来说,在使用new运算符时需要提供目标对象的类名,然后Java虚拟机就会为该类创建一个对象,并为其分配内存。但是,这个对象虽然被创建出来了,但是它并没有被初始化。

那么,如何对对象进行初始化呢?Java提供了两种方法,一种是使用构造器,另一种是使用对象初始化块。构造器是一种特殊的方法,它与类同名,没有返回类型,用来初始化新创建的对象。当我们使用new运算符创建对象时,它实际上是调用类的构造器来创建对象的。

而对象初始化块是一段普通的代码块,它被包含在花括号{}中,用来初始化实例变量。当对象被创建时,对象初始化块会优先于构造器执行。它的作用是为对象的实例变量提供初始化值。

因此,通过使用构造器或对象初始化块,我们可以对Java中的对象进行初始化,从而为后续操作提供基础。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复